Career path

Career Role Description
IEP Development Consultant Develop and implement Individual Education Programmes (IEPs) for students with special educational needs, ensuring alignment with national standards and best practices. High demand for expertise in SEND (Special Educational Needs and Disabilities) legislation.
IEP Coordinator (Primary/Secondary) Manage and coordinate the IEP process within a school setting, overseeing the development and review of IEPs for a designated group of students. Requires strong organizational and communication skills.
SENDCO (Special Educational Needs Coordinator) Lead the school's provision for students with SEND, including the development and implementation of effective IEPs. Requires significant experience and leadership qualities in SEND.
IEP Implementation Specialist Specialize in the practical implementation of IEPs, providing training and support to teachers and other school staff. Expertise in assistive technology and inclusive practices is highly valued.
Educational Psychologist (IEP Focus) Conduct assessments and provide recommendations for IEP development, focusing on psychological and learning needs. Expertise in cognitive and behavioral development.
